Problem 8
Which of the following is NOT primarily a protein-based biological molecule?
A
Steroid hormones such as cortisol, which are synthesized from cholesterol and act through intracellular receptors rather than being composed of amino acids
B
Hemoglobin, a tetrameric protein that transports oxygen in red blood cells
C
Many enzymes, which are protein catalysts that increase reaction rates in metabolism
D
Insulin, a peptide hormone that is synthesized as a protein and regulates blood glucose
